免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ue 开发安卓

Vue是一款流行的JavaScript框架,常用于构建单页应用程序(SPA),它具有轻量级、高效、易学易用的特点。在移动端开发中,我们可以使用Vue来构建安卓应用程序,这里介绍一下Vue开发安卓的原理和详细步骤。

一、原理

Vue开发安卓应用程序的原理是利用Vue的组件化开发特点,将安卓应用程序的各个模块封装成Vue组件,然后在Vue框架中动态渲染这些组件,最终构建出安卓应用程序的界面。

具体实现步骤如下:

1. 使用Vue CLI创建安卓项目

Vue CLI是一个官方发布的命令行工具,用于快速搭建Vue项目。我们可以使用Vue CLI来创建安卓项目,具体步骤如下:

(1)安装Vue CLI

在终端中输入以下命令进行安装:

```

npm install -g @vue/cli

```

(2)创建项目

在终端中输入以下命令进行创建:

```

vue create my-app

```

其中,my-app为项目名称。

(3)安装安卓插件

在终端中进入项目目录,然后输入以下命令进行安装:

```

vue add cordova

```

Cordova是一款开源的移动应用程序开发框架,可以将Web应用程序打包成原生应用程序。通过安装Cordova插件,我们可以将Vue项目打包成安卓应用程序。

2. 编写Vue组件

在Vue项目中,我们需要编写Vue组件来构建安卓应用程序的界面。Vue组件是Vue框架的核心,它由模板、数据和方法组成。我们可以使用Vue CLI生成的模板来编写Vue组件,也可以自行编写模板。

3. 打包成安卓应用程序

完成Vue组件的编写后,我们需要将Vue项目打包成安卓应用程序。具体步骤如下:

(1)在终端中进入项目目录,然后输入以下命令进行打包:

```

npm run cordova-prepare

npm run cordova-build-android

```

其中,cordova-prepare命令用于准备打包环境,cordova-build-android命令用于打包成安卓应用程序。

(2)打包完成后,在项目目录下的platforms/android/app/build/outputs/apk目录中可以找到apk文件,这个文件就是我们打包好的安卓应用程序。

二、详细介绍

1. 创建Vue项目

使用Vue CLI创建Vue项目,具体步骤如下:

(1)安装Vue CLI

在终端中输入以下命令进行安装:

```

npm install -g @vue/cli

```

(2)创建项目

在终端中输入以下命令进行创建:

```

vue create my-app

```

其中,my-app为项目名称。

(3)启动项目

在终端中进入项目目录,然后输入以下命令启动项目:

```

npm run serve

```

这个命令会启动一个本地服务器,我们可以在浏览器中访问http://localhost:8080来预览项目。

2. 编写Vue组件

在Vue项目中,我们需要编写Vue组件来构建安卓应用程序的界面。Vue组件是Vue框架的核心,它由模板、数据和方法组成。我们可以使用Vue CLI生成的模板来编写Vue组件,也可以自行编写模板。

以HelloWorld组件为例,代码如下:

```

```

这个组件包含一个h1标签和一个按钮,点击按钮可以改变h1标签中的内容。

3. 打包成安卓应用程序

完成Vue组件的编写后,我们需要将Vue项目打包成安卓应用程序。具体步骤如下:

(1)在终端中进入项目目录,然后输入以下命令进行打包:

```

npm run cordova-prepare

npm run cordova-build-android

```

其中,cordova-prepare命令用于准备打包环境,cordova-build-android命令用于打包成安卓应用程序。

(2)打包完成后,在项目目录下的platforms/android/app/build/outputs/apk目录中可以找到apk文件,这个文件就是我们打包好的安卓应用程序。

4. 安装和运行安卓应用程序

将apk文件拷贝到安卓手机中,然后在手机中安装即可。安装完成后,我们可以在手机中打开应用程序,预览我们编写的Vue组件。

总结

以上就是Vue开发安卓应用程序的原理和详细步骤。在移动端开发中,Vue可以帮助我们快速构建高效、易用的安卓应用程序。如果你对Vue开发安卓应用程序感兴趣,可以尝试使用Vue CLI创建一个安卓项目,然后编写自己的Vue组件,最终打包成安卓应用程序。


相关知识:
android多人开发
在Android开发中,多人开发是很常见的。多人开发可以提高开发效率,同时也可以让项目更加稳定。在多人开发中,需要考虑很多方面,如代码管理、分支管理、协作开发等等。本文将介绍Android多人开发的原理和详细方法。一、代码管理代码管理是多人开发中最重要的环
2023-04-06
软件转ipa
在iOS系统中,应用程序的安装包格式是.ipa。而在开发iOS应用时,通常使用Xcode软件进行编译,生成的文件格式为.app。那么,如何将.app格式的文件转换为.ipa格式的文件呢?这就需要使用软件转换工具了。软件转换ipa的原理其实很简单,就是将.a
2023-04-06
安卓共存版制作
安卓共存版是指可以在同一台手机上同时安装多个不同版本的安卓系统的一种技术。这种技术主要是通过虚拟化技术实现的,即在手机上创建一个虚拟的安卓系统环境,从而实现多个安卓系统的共存。实现安卓共存版的方法主要有两种,一种是通过第三方软件实现,另一种是通过刷机实现。
2023-04-06
ios p8
iOS P8是一种用于iOS设备的越狱工具,它可以帮助用户解除设备的限制,获得更多的控制权和自由度。在本文中,我们将对iOS P8进行详细介绍,包括其原理、使用方法和注意事项等方面。一、iOS P8的原理iOS P8的原理是通过利用iOS系统中的漏洞,来获
2023-04-06
安卓app封装
安卓App封装是将一个安卓应用程序打包为一个APK文件的过程。APK文件是安卓应用程序的标准安装包,包含了应用程序的代码、资源文件和清单文件等。在App封装的过程中,开发者可以选择使用一些工具和技术来增强应用程序的功能和性能。一、App封装的原理App封装
2023-04-06
快速打包ios
iOS是一种移动操作系统,被广泛应用于iPhone、iPad、iPod Touch等苹果公司的移动设备上。在iOS开发中,打包是一个重要的步骤,它将应用程序从开发环境中导出并打包成可安装的文件,以供用户在设备上安装和使用。iOS应用程序的打包过程包括以下几
2023-04-06
小火箭ipa软件
小火箭IPA软件是一款在iOS设备上使用的科学上网工具,它可以帮助用户访问被封锁的网站,保护用户的隐私和安全。小火箭软件的原理是通过VPN技术来实现科学上网。VPN是Virtual Private Network(虚拟私人网络)的缩写,它是一种通过公共网络
2023-04-06
ipa发布工具altool
IPA是iOS应用程序的安装包,发布iOS应用程序通常需要将IPA文件上传到App Store Connect。Apple提供了一个命令行工具altool,用于验证和上传IPA文件。altool是Xcode Command Line Tools的一部分,可
2023-04-06
安卓aab应用
Android应用程序包(Android Application Package,简称APK)是Android应用程序的安装包。随着Google Play的发展,APK成为了Android应用程序的标准格式。但是,在2018年,Google推出了一种新的应
2023-04-06
安卓app开发软件
安卓(Android)是一种流行的移动操作系统,由Google公司开发。安卓应用程序(App)是指在安卓操作系统上运行的软件程序。安卓应用程序可以使用Java语言和Android SDK(Software Development Kit)进行开发。本文将介
2023-04-06
鸿蒙app开发流程说明
鸿蒙操作系统是华为公司自主研发的一款全场景智能操作系统,其核心理念是分布式技术,能够支持多种设备之间的快速互联和协同工作。鸿蒙的开发语言主要是基于Java语言的HarmonyOS SDK和基于C/C++语言的OpenHarmony SDK。在鸿蒙操作系统上,开发者可以开发出各种类型的应用程序,包括鸿蒙app。
2023-04-03
文章营销
2019-01-17